Action item: The Relayn deploy-status bot silently dropped updates when the pipeline API paginated results, so responders believed a rollback had completed when it had not. We will add pagination handling, a staleness banner, and an integration test. Until merged, verify deploy state directly in the pipeline console, documented at the page below.

runbook for kahop-kajop: https://rundeck.ordinio.test/display/secrets/pipeline/issue/pages/repo/browse/e5732776e07d1285107e5aeb

## Capacity Note: Incremental Rebuilds in Stonepress

Plugin authors: incremental rebuilds in Stonepress are bounded per publish cycle. If your plugin invalidates more pages than the rebuild budget allows, the remainder queues for the next cycle, which can delay content propagation. Keep invalidation footprints small — prefer targeted cache keys over site-wide purges. Budgets scale with plan tier but the baseline limits, enforced on every tenant, are the following constants.

limits module of tahof-tawig:
WEIGHTS = {
    "fenwyn": 285,
    "briiel": 528,
    "druiel": 1023,
    "kasax": 747,
    "jordor": 334,
}

Subject: On-call handover — TideTrace widget

Hi Marisol, handing over the TideTrace tide-table widget. The harbor-data poller for the Pellan Cove feed failed twice overnight; I restarted it and added retry logging. Watch for gaps in the 6-hour forecast panel — that's the first symptom. Notes are in the runbook. Questions from future maintainers should go to the widget team's shared inbox.

escalation mailbox, bafog-fafog: ulador@paliqlabs.internal

**Q: Why does the replica-lag alarm for Quillbase fire during the nightly ETL window?**

The alarm threshold on the Quillbase read replicas is 30 seconds, and the nightly ETL run from Harrowell Analytics routinely pushes lag past that. Before silencing, verify lag recovers within ten minutes; if not, the replication slot may be wedged and needs a manual reset via the recovery console. Access to that console requires the standby recovery passphrase, reproduced below for reviewers.

unlock words, bahop-fawef: novmir-druwyn-soriel-rusdor-kasion